Valuable items[edit]
The following are items that can either be purchased or sold from the Pim's pawn shop in Minea. While the prices are fixed in the original version, it's possible to haggle with Pim a bit in the remakes.
Ruby | Sapphire Ring |
---|---|
Sell in Minea for 1200 Gold. "A ruby set in gold. Its condition is virtually flawless." |
Give to the one-eyed man in the bar for a 1500 Gold reward. "Sapphire-encrusted ring inscribed with a message from its giver." |
Necklace | Golden Vase |
Sell in Minea for 500 Gold. "Gold necklace adorned with countless small rubies and patterns." |
Sell in Minea for 2000 Gold. "Beautiful golden vase. Has a hole for some variety of ornament." |
Usable items[edit]
Once you use one of these items, it disappears from your inventory and you must purchase or find another one. There is no limit to how many you may find or buy them, but you may only hold one of each in your inventory at a time.
Heal Potion | Wing |
---|---|
Depending on which version you're playing, it may cost 1000 Gold, or 300 Gold in the remakes. "Medicine made from the Red Digitalis plant. Heals mind and body." |
Depending on which version you're playing, it may cost 2000 Gold, or 200 Gold in the remakes. "Magic wing. Warps the user to Minea. Some areas seal its power." |
Mirror | |
Depending on which version you're playing, it may cost 1000 Gold, or 500 Gold in the remakes. "Mirror that can freeze a single movement. Will break with overuse." |
